Wagers v. Warden, Lebanon Corr. Inst.
This is a habeas corpus case brought pro se by Petitioner Gene Wagers, Jr., to obtain release from five concurrent terms of life imprisonment he is serving in Respondent's custody after conviction in the Preble County Common Pleas Court on four counts of rape in violation of Ohio Revised Code § 2907.02(A)(1)(b), one count of rape in violation of Ohio Revised Code § 2907.02(A)(2), four counts of sexual battery in violation of Ohio Revised Code § 2907.03A)(5), and one count of disseminating material harmful to juveniles in violation of Ohio Revised Code § 2907.31(A)(3), the first nine counts carrying a sexually violent perpetrator specification (Petition, Doc. No. 2, ¶ 5, PageID 2).

The case is before the Court for initial review under Rule 4 of the Rules Governing § 2254 Cases which provides in pertinent part:
If it plainly appears from the petition and any attached exhibits that the petitioner is not entitled to relief in the district court, the judge must dismiss the petition and direct the clerk to notify the petitioner.
Because Petitioner raised his claims in the state courts and the state appellate court decisions are publicly available, the Court is able to consider them in its Rule 4 analysis.
